Other key parts of the window are the side jambs, the meeting rails and Sash bars. The side jambs are situated inside the frame and offer additional structural support. They are horizontal parts that run between the lower sash and upper sash. They permit them to slide between the two. Lastly, sash bars are the wooden stretches which separate and support individual glass panes within each sash.

Window sashes also have frames, counterbalances and a balance system that allows them to move up and sideways or down. They can be cranked, sliding open or corded up to open like a front door. The original systems were created to counter gravitational forces by using a weight and pulley system. Modern versions have replaced the weights with spring balances.

The overall cost of your sash windows will depend on the dimensions and style of your window and the glass options and any other special features you might require. The price of bent sashes, as well as Muntins which are decorative grids that are embedded in the glass, is higher than a standard double-glazed sash window. If you choose a more energy-efficient glass, like low-E or gas argon, your sash windows will cost more to replace.
